Output e937456a6b1da65181a8eb630c2f40f2cc26b1afa54aa6b3b705545fe1897f98:0

value
1678300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b551bc9f3ed1bcb3ee893fed6fbfa917a573a327 OP_EQUAL
address
3JDk9SM6otNe1cBPdNEkWpSUGQyKtGRCa6
transaction
e937456a6b1da65181a8eb630c2f40f2cc26b1afa54aa6b3b705545fe1897f98